Episode 14: Uncovering Worthiness
In Episode 14 of Compassion Collective, we discuss the notion of worthiness as something we all innately have as human beings. Rather than waiting for the feeling of worthiness to occur and affirm that we are indeed worthy, what would it look like to lead with behaviors that communicate worthiness and notice the experiences that follow. Episode 11: Cultivating Calm
In Episode 11 of Compassion Collective, we discuss the 3 circle model of emotion regulation in depth and focus on how we can begin to strengthen our soothing-affiliative system and cultivate greater calm in our lives. Episode 10: Living Our Values
In Episode 10 of Compassion Collective, we speak with Dr. Steve Bisgaier, a clinical psychologist and expert in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T). In this episode, we learn about the overlap between ACT and self-compassion and explore how these practices can help us live in greater alignment with our values. Episode 5: Reflections on Our Conversation with Dr. Russell Kolts
In Episode 5 of Compassion Collective, we reflect on our discussion with Dr. Russell Kolts, Ph.D. We discuss the components of our emotion regulation system (i.e., threat, drive, and soothing modes) and identify ways in which they play out in our daily lives. We discuss tools that we can use to activate and tap into our soothing system using self-awareness and self-compassion. Episode 4: It Takes Courage
In Episode 4 of Compassion Collective, we sit down with licensed clinical psychologist, Dr. Russell Kolts, founder of Inland Northwest Compassionate Mind Center in Spokane Valley, Washington. In this interview, we explore stigma and gender stereotypes related to compassion, as well as how self-compassion can be used to help us cope with anger and other intense emotions that arise.
